The design of an injection mold is influenced by various factors, including the type of plastic material being used, the complexity of the product design, and the production volume. It is essential to tailor the mold design to the specific requirements of the project to optimize production efficiency and product quality. Factors such as cooling system design, gate placement, and part ejection mechanisms all contribute to the overall performance of the injection mold.

Additionally, technology advancements in injection mold design have revolutionized the manufacturing industry. Computer-aided design (CAD) software allows designers to create intricate mold designs with precision and accuracy. Simulation software enables engineers to analyze the mold’s performance virtually, identifying potential issues and making necessary adjustments before manufacturing.
